Chronically unemployed, dumped by his wife and stuck in a dead-end trailer park with nothing but a three-legged dog for company, Tom decides it's time to take the Big Dirt Nap.
But when he ties sixty weather balloons to a La-Z-Boy recliner to make his grand exit, something unexpected happens. He floats into heaven. Where he finds out he still has one champion in his corner: God Himself. Or Herself -- as in Oprah -- which is how God appears to Tom.
God talks a reluctant Tom into returning to earth as God's envoy, to deliver a simple one-word message to the world. But it soon becomes apparent that Tom might not be the man for the job.
